How To Fix S95_MESSAGES010 - Processing &1: No alert categories found for &1 message type


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: S95_MESSAGES - S95 Message Processing

  • Message number: 010

  • Message text: Processing &1: No alert categories found for &1 message type

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message S95_MESSAGES010 - Processing &1: No alert categories found for &1 message type ?

    The SAP error message S95_MESSAGES010 indicates that there are no alert categories found for a specific message type in the SAP system. This error typically arises in the context of the SAP Alert Management system, which is used to monitor and manage alerts generated by various processes within the SAP environment.

    Cause:

    The error can occur due to several reasons:

    1. Missing Configuration: The alert categories for the specified message type have not been configured in the system.
    2. Incorrect Message Type: The message type being referenced may not be valid or may not have been set up correctly.
    3. Transport Issues: If the configuration was recently transported from another system, it may not have been transported correctly, leading to missing entries.
    4.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to view or access the alert categories.

    Solution:

    To resolve the error, you can take the following steps:

    1. Check Alert Category Configuration:

      • Go to transaction code ALRTCATDEF to check if the alert categories for the specified message type are defined.
      • If they are missing, you will need to create the necessary alert categories.
    2. Define Alert Categories:

      • If you find that the alert categories are not defined, you can create them by following these steps:
        • In the Alert Category Definition screen, create a new alert category and assign it to the relevant message type.
        • Ensure that the alert category is active and properly configured.
    3. Verify Message Type:

      • Ensure that the message type you are using is correct and that it corresponds to the alert categories you are trying to access.
    4. Check Transport Requests:

      • If the configuration was recently transported, check the transport logs to ensure that all necessary objects were included and that there were no errors during the transport.
    5. User Authorizations:

      • Verify that the user encountering the error has the necessary authorizations to access the alert categories. You may need to consult with your SAP security team to ensure proper roles are assigned.
    6. Consult Documentation:

      • Review SAP documentation or notes related to alert management for any additional configuration steps or known issues.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es:
      • ALRTCATDEF: Alert Category Definition
      • ALRTDISP: Alert Display
